Divine Mercy Sunday — Solemn Mass & Adoration

The Second Sunday of Easter is designated as Divine Mercy Sunday by the Church. We celebrate Solemn Mass at 11:00 am with special music from the parish choir, followed by the Chaplet of Divine Mercy and Benediction of the Blessed Sacrament. All are most warmly welcome to this beautiful celebration of God's inexhaustible mercy.

Day Pilgrimage to Walsingham

Our annual coach pilgrimage to the National Shrine of Our Lady at Walsingham in Norfolk — England's Nazareth. We depart from the church car park at 6:00 am, arriving at the Shrine for the 10:30 am Mass. The afternoon includes time to walk the Holy Mile, visit the Slipper Chapel, and take part in the afternoon Rosary procession. Coach departs for home at 5:00 pm.

Corpus Christi Procession

The Feast of Corpus Christi — the Body and Blood of Christ — is one of the great solemnities of the Church's year. After the 11:00 am Solemn Mass, we will process with the Blessed Sacrament through the parish grounds and surrounding streets, singing hymns in honour of Our Lord in the Eucharist. Children who have made their First Holy Communion are especially encouraged to attend.
